     COST
     (European Cooperation
     in Science and Technology)
     is a pan-European inter-
     governmental framework.

     Its mission is to enable
     break-through scientific and
     technological developments
     leading to new concepts and
     products and thereby contribute
     to strengthening Europe’s
     research and innovation
     capacities. www.cost.eu.

Dr. Janine SCHWEIER

js_20140507 

 

Institution: Albert-Ludwigs-University of Freiburg
Chair of Forest utilization
E-mail: Janine.schweier@forestenf.uni-freiburg.de
Role in the Action: MC member, organization of the action, vice leader WG 3

Phonenumer: +4976120397616 (office)

 

 

Research interests related to EuroCoppice

  • harvesting
  • productivity
  • supply chain
  • Life Cycle Analysis (LCA)

Publications related to EuroCoppice

 

  • Schweier J, Spinelli R, Magagnotti N. 2015. Mechanized coppice harvesting with new smallscale feller-bunchers: Results from harvesting trials with newly manufactured felling heads in Italy. Biomass and Bioenergy (72): 85-94. http://dx.doi.org/10.1016/j.biombioe.2014.11.013.

  • Vanbeveren S, Schweier J, Berhongaray G, Ceulemans R. 2015. Non-industrial, short rotation woody crop plantations: manual or mechanised harvesting? Biomass and Bioenergy (72): 8-18.
     
  • Schweier J. Production from energy wood from short rotation coppice on agricultural marginal land in south-west Germany-environmental and economic assessment of alternative supply concepts with particular regard on different harvesting systems. München: Publisher Dr. Hut;2013. p. 289. German.

  • Schweier J, Becker G. 2013. Economics of poplar short rotation coppice plantations on marginal land in Germany. Biomass and Bioenergy (59): 494-502. http://dx.doi.org/10.1016/j.biombioe.2013.10.020.

 

  • Aust C., Schweier J., Brodbeck F., Sauter U.H., Becker G., Schnitzler J.-P. 2013. Woody biomass production potential of short rotation coppices on agricultural land in Germany. Global Change Biology Bioenergy (5): 13 pages. DOI: 10.1111/gcbb.12083.
     
  • Schweier, J. Becker G. 2012. New Holland forage harvester’s productivity in short rotation coppice- Evaluation of field studies from a German perspective. IJFE 23 (2): 82-88.

 

  • Schweier, J. Becker G. 2012. Manuelle Ernte von Kurzumtriebsplantagen in Südwestdeutschland. AFJZ 183 (7/8): 159- 167.
